Role:
In this role, you will operate in an exciting, technologically demanding, and varied working environment. You will take responsibility in the areas of procurement and supply chain and contribute to shaping modern technologies in an international context.
Responsibilities:
Planning and controlling material and procurement requirements at both operational and strategic levels
Ensuring demand-oriented supply for projects, manufacturing, and after-sales areas
Further development of inventory levels, disposition parameters, and stock concepts
Early detection of possible procurement and supply bottlenecks and development of appropriate countermeasures
Creation, review, and ongoing updating of technical bills of materials for projects
Early coordination with project purchasing regarding critical materials, procurement times, and suitable purchasing strategies
Building and long-term development of a high-performance supplier network domestically and abroad
Management and optimisation of supplier information, purchasing conditions, and relevant master data
Assessment of supplier performance and initiation of measures for sustainable improvement
Participation in interdisciplinary projects to optimise processes and digitalise workflows
Coordination with the departments of design/engineering, project management, manufacturing, and purchasing
Support of purchasing management in conceptual, organisational, and strategic matters
Qualifications:
Technical basic training, supplemented by further education in purchasing, supply chain, logistics, business administration, or a comparable field
Solid professional experience in at least one of the areas of purchasing, disposition, supply chain, work preparation, or industrial project management
Confident handling of technical bills of materials, material requirements planning, and common ERP solutions
Knowledge in the field of machinery, plant, or technical equipment manufacturing is helpful
Very good German skills as well as good English skills for daily collaboration
Strong analytical skills combined with a good understanding of processes, costs, and economic contexts
Independent and systematic approach with a strong solution orientation
Convincing appearance and the ability to represent interests to various internal and external contacts
Strong communication and teamwork skills as well as a high level of responsibility
